Caesar Posted December 7, 2005 Posted December 7, 2005 Hello, all. I was wondering if anyone could field this question for me: what are the engine thrust units in the aircraft data files? To clarify, I'm trying to set up a "what if" situation with the F-14, that being, what if the advanced experimental F401-P400 engines for the original F-14B in 1973 had been employed. When looking at the engine's thrust, however, I found the units not to be in pounds or kilograms or newtons. Can anyone tell me what the thrust is rated in in WoV/SF? Thanks in advance.
+Fubar512 Posted December 7, 2005 Posted December 7, 2005 The thrust value in SF is measured in Newtons. 1 lbs thrust = 4.448 Newtons
Caesar Posted December 7, 2005 Author Posted December 7, 2005 Oh, thank you very much. I must have miscalculated a ratio. When I tried to figure the units I compared to pounds and got 5.444, which is why I had assumed they weren't Newtons. Thanks again.
